Abstract:
Modern educational system is intensively searching for a new educational technology relevant to the challenge of specialists’ training. The focus is on research of the issues related to the mobility of students of various typological groups and individuals looking for professional development. Some efficient and more cost-effective approach is being pursued, alongside with the ones dealing with actual physical movement of learners. These approaches include virtual mobility as well as in-house mobility within the university educational environment.

In the academic year of 2015-2016 Southern Federal University (Russian Federation) has launched a new strategy of academic process management, namely the "Week of academic mobility" project. The article aims at describing the intramural mobility technology in terms of its practical implementation to show its benefits and drawbacks. The analysis of the technology’s essence and procedure is given (with due emphasis on the forms of educational process organization and management, the content of the students’ projects, open unconventional academic activities). The university’s administrative documents and interviews with different groups of respondents provide the basis for analysis. It shows how the forming effect of the technology is evaluated by the senior administrative staff of the University (at the level of vice-rectors and heads of administrative departments), heads of educational structural units (deans, directors of institutes), employers, teachers, students.

The article concludes by stating that alternativeness and innovativeness are characteristic to intramural academic mobility technology in terms of its concept, efficiency and curriculum content. The technology’s further development potential is being demonstrated. The necessity for it, as well as possible way of improvement, is pointed out by all the respondents, involved in the process of education.
